Output 85f8c600810143a760e81c62ef9cd44f64b7cb5e26a94b7c2833fb4e323a238b:40

value
1861539
script pubkey
OP_0 OP_PUSHBYTES_20 7dde629c4edab83dde7bf2e60c97c7b5abf56202
address
bc1q0h0x98zwm2urmhnm7tnqe978kk4l2cszpejq5m
transaction
85f8c600810143a760e81c62ef9cd44f64b7cb5e26a94b7c2833fb4e323a238b